ततस्तं लोभसंयुक्ता ममंथुः सागरं नृप । पद्महस्तात्र संजाता ततो लक्ष्मीः सितांबरा
tatastaṃ lobhasaṃyuktā mamaṃthuḥ sāgaraṃ nṛpa | padmahastātra saṃjātā tato lakṣmīḥ sitāṃbarā
បន្ទាប់មក ដោយលោភលន់ ពួកគេបានកូរមហាសមុទ្រនោះម្តងទៀត ឱ ព្រះមហាក្សត្រ; ហើយព្រះលក្ខ្មី ស្លៀកពណ៌ស កាន់ផ្កាឈូកក្នុងដៃ បានកើតឡើងនៅទីនោះ។

Scene: From the churned ocean, Lakṣmī arises luminous, clad in white, holding a lotus; the sea calms around her as devas and dānavas pause, struck by her beauty and auspicious presence.
From intense striving arise divine auspiciousness (Lakṣmī); yet greed is cautioned as a motive that disturbs harmony.
